The Justice of the Swiss canton of Valais has confirmed the provisional release for Jessica Morettico-owner of the bar Le Constellation, where A fire on New Year’s Eve caused the death of 40 young people in the alpine resort of Crans Montana.

The cantonal Court of Coercive Measures has prohibited the co-owner from leaving Swiss territory and has imposed the obligation to report daily to a police stationthe judicial instance indicated in a statement.

In addition, Moretti must deposit all his identity and residence documents with the Public Ministry, and will have to pay a bail “adequate” whose amount has not yet been set and “will be determined later,” the court statement added.

Risk of escape

her husband, Jacques Moretti, remains in provisional detention, issued on Monday by the same court, which, however, left the door open for him to also be released on bail if the Prosecutor’s Office so deems it.

Precautionary measures for marriage have been imposed before the risk of flight of both, as indicated by the Valencian court.

The owner of the damaged establishment was arrested on Friday, January 9, at the end of a hearing called by the Prosecutor’s Office within the criminal investigation opened after the tragedy, while his wife was able to leave the courthouse at the end of the interrogations.

40 muertos

Both are investigated for possible crimes of homicide, arson and bodily injury due to negligence.

In the tragedy of the alpine resort of Crans Montana 116 people were injured, the vast majority with severe burns, while half of the 40 deaths were minors.

According to the evidence gathered, the fire originated from sparks from flares attached to bottles, which ignited the soundproofing foam that covered the ceiling, which in turn caused the flames to spread almost immediately throughout the premises.
